I've been successfully jailbraking 2 consoles without any problem. I just checked the MD5 of the patch file on USB drive and didn't bother with flash dumps, as it's actually more expensive to get a e3 flasher / Teensy than a used PS3.

Anyway, just out of curiosity, what if I patch the flash, make a dump but the dump checker reports the dump is bad? Obviously, I can't install the firmware again, which will reboot the PS3 and result in instant brick. Do I run the flash writer again with the correct patch file? This doesn't sound like a valid option either, since bad data has already been patched to flash.
 
I've been successfully jailbraking 2 consoles without any problem. I just checked the MD5 of the patch file on USB drive and didn't bother with flash dumps, as it's actually more expensive to get a e3 flasher / Teensy than a used PS3.

Anyway, just out of curiosity, what if I patch the flash, make a dump but the dump checker reports the dump is bad? Obviously, I can't install the firmware again, which will reboot the PS3 and result in instant brick. Do I run the flash writer again with the correct patch file? This doesn't sound like a valid option either, since bad data has already been patched to flash.
patching again with correct file or using HDD method at that point, before reboot, would be your best option , yes

and then of course, re-dump to verify patch

if you get stuck in some state of disrepair, then idk of another option other than hardware flasher at that point for current tools

flash_484.hex is only for those downgrable units which can't be used on 3K and 4K slims including your model.

The reason why this part can be extremely dangerous is that the flasher itself doesn't stop flashing 3K/4K models which is why we warn people and have them validate their minimum version before proceeding any further, and even after flashing, in case of situation like @shab, verification step was recommended before rebooting so he would have saved his console from bricking that was caused by corrupted hex file that he downloaded.

So, a couple of things could have saved his PS3, such as

1. Verification of hex file (which was suggested in the flash writer post).
2. Verification of patched dump before rebooting PS3 (which was suggested in the flash writer post).
